Output 2f944c9e710422ef17efa2a71594416fbc813a922c9a53ea299c65a73db0a506:1

value
27586631
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 446e2ebebcf599403de41c0244980429eec5ed67 OP_EQUALVERIFY OP_CHECKSIG
address
17Epwfc2cX6UwXJefo3FDqeFQeLm1GhfLj
transaction
2f944c9e710422ef17efa2a71594416fbc813a922c9a53ea299c65a73db0a506
spent
true